/*
Task
Given three integers a ,b ,c, return the largest number obtained after inserting the following operators and brackets: +, *, ()
In other words , try every combination of a,b,c with [*+()] , and return the Maximum Obtained (Read the notes for more detail about it)
Example
With the numbers are 1, 2 and 3 , here are some ways of placing signs and brackets:
1 * (2 + 3) = 5
1 * 2 * 3 = 6
1 + 2 * 3 = 7
(1 + 2) * 3 = 9
So the maximum value that you can obtain is 9.
Notes
The numbers are always positive.
The numbers are in the range (1 ≤ a, b, c ≤ 10).
You can use the same operation more than once.
It's not necessary to place all the signs and brackets.
Repetition in numbers may occur .
You cannot swap the operands. For instance, in the given example you cannot get expression (1 + 3) * 2 = 8.
Input >> Output Examples:
expressionsMatter(1,2,3) ==> return 9
Explanation:
After placing signs and brackets, the Maximum value obtained from the expression (1+2) * 3 = 9.
expressionsMatter(1,1,1) ==> return 3
Explanation:
After placing signs, the Maximum value obtained from the expression is 1 + 1 + 1 = 3.
expressionsMatter(9,1,1) ==> return 18
Explanation:
After placing signs and brackets, the Maximum value obtained from the expression is 9 * (1+1) = 18. ___# Task

export function expressionsMatter(a: number, b: number, c: number): number {
const i = a * (b + c);
const j = a + b + c;
const x = a * b * c;
const y = a + b * c;
const z = (a + b) * c;
return Math.max(i,j,x,y,z);
}
